Analytical Scientist | RESEARCH SCIENTIST I (CHEMICAL SCIENCES)
The incumbent works under the supervision of the Research Scientist Supervisor I (RSS I) Chemical Sciences (CS), Chief of the Pb & Inorganic Testing Unit. The Research Scientist I (RS I) (CS) plans, organizes, and carries out scientific research studies of limited scope and complexity related to source identification and quantitative assessment of human exposure to toxic metals, primarily lead, in support of the California Department of Public Health (CDPH) Childhood Lead Poisoning Prevention Program. The RS I develops methods and performs chemical analyses to identify the concentration of lead in environmental and biological samples; prepares samples, standards, and reagents; interprets and reports laboratory sample results; and documents quality assurance.
